1. Mastering the Art of Chain Tensioning
Chain tension is absolutely crucial for safe and efficient chainsaw operation. Too loose, and the chain can derail, causing serious injury. Too tight, and it can bind, overheat, and damage the bar and sprocket. Finding that sweet spot is key.
Why Correct Chain Tension Matters
- Safety: A properly tensioned chain is less likely to derail and cause kickback.
- Performance: Correct tension ensures the chain cuts smoothly and efficiently, reducing strain on the engine.
- Lifespan: Proper tension minimizes wear and tear on the chain, bar, and sprocket, extending their lifespan.
The “Pull-Up” Test: A Practical Approach
My grandfather taught me a simple test that I still use today: the “pull-up” test.
- Cool Down: Make sure the chainsaw is cool before adjusting the tension. A hot chain will expand, leading to inaccurate adjustments.
- Loosen the Bar Nuts: Using the wrench provided with your CS4400, slightly loosen the bar nuts. This allows the bar to move and the chain to be adjusted.
- Adjust the Tensioning Screw: Locate the chain tensioning screw, usually on the side of the chainsaw near the bar. Turn the screw clockwise to tighten the chain and counterclockwise to loosen it.
- The Pull-Up Test: Pull the chain down from the middle of the bar. The drive links (the part of the chain that fits into the bar groove) should still be slightly engaged in the bar groove. You should be able to pull the chain out about 1/8 inch (3mm).
- Tighten the Bar Nuts: Once you’ve achieved the correct tension, tighten the bar nuts securely.
- Re-Check: After tightening, re-check the tension to ensure it hasn’t changed.
Common Mistakes and How to Avoid Them
- Adjusting a Hot Chain: Always allow the chain to cool before adjusting tension.
- Over-Tightening: Over-tightening can lead to premature wear and damage. Err on the side of slightly looser rather than too tight.
- Ignoring Temperature Changes: Chain tension will change with temperature. Check and adjust the tension periodically, especially when working in varying weather conditions.

2. Optimizing Cutting Techniques for Different Wood Types
Not all wood is created equal. Softwoods like pine and fir cut differently than hardwoods like oak and maple. Understanding these differences and adjusting your cutting techniques accordingly can significantly improve your efficiency and reduce wear and tear on your chainsaw.
Understanding Wood Density and Grain
- Softwoods: Generally have lower density and a more consistent grain, making them easier to cut.
- Hardwoods: Have higher density and often a more complex grain, requiring more power and precision to cut.
Cutting Techniques for Softwoods
- Aggressive Cutting: With softwoods, you can generally use a more aggressive cutting technique, applying more pressure to the bar.
- Full Throttle: Maintain full throttle for consistent cutting speed.
- Sharp Chain: Ensure your chain is sharp for optimal performance.
Cutting Techniques for Hardwoods
- Controlled Cutting: Use a more controlled cutting technique, applying less pressure to the bar.
- Moderate Throttle: Avoid bogging down the engine by using a moderate throttle.
- Sharp Chain: A sharp chain is even more critical when cutting hardwoods.
- Kerf Management: Be mindful of the kerf (the width of the cut) and use wedges if necessary to prevent the bar from binding.
Specialized Cuts: Notching and Felling
- Notching: When felling trees, the notch determines the direction of the fall. A properly executed notch is crucial for safety. Aim for a notch that is about 1/3 of the tree’s diameter.
- Felling Cut: The felling cut should be made slightly above the notch, leaving a hinge of wood to control the fall.

3. Mastering Filing Techniques for a Razor-Sharp Chain
A sharp chain is essential for safe and efficient chainsaw operation. A dull chain not only makes cutting more difficult but also increases the risk of kickback. Mastering filing techniques is a skill that will save you time, money, and potential injury.
Why a Sharp Chain Matters
- Safety: A sharp chain is less likely to kick back.
- Performance: A sharp chain cuts faster and more efficiently.
- Lifespan: A sharp chain reduces strain on the engine and extends the lifespan of the bar and chain.
The Anatomy of a Chainsaw Tooth
Before you start filing, it’s important to understand the anatomy of a chainsaw tooth. Each tooth consists of:
- Cutter: The part of the tooth that does the cutting.
- Depth Gauge (Raker): The part of the tooth that controls the depth of the cut.
Tools You’ll Need
- Chainsaw File: A round file specifically designed for sharpening chainsaw teeth.
- File Guide: A tool that helps you maintain the correct filing angle and depth.
- Depth Gauge Tool: A tool for adjusting the depth gauges (rakers).
- Vise: A vise to hold the chainsaw securely while you’re filing.
- Gloves: To protect your hands.
Step-by-Step Filing Guide
- Secure the Chainsaw: Place the chainsaw in a vise to hold it securely.
- Identify the Correct File Size: Consult your chainsaw’s manual to determine the correct file size for your chain.
- Use a File Guide: Place the file guide on the chain, aligning it with the cutting edge of the tooth.
- File at the Correct Angle: Maintain the correct filing angle, as indicated on the file guide. This is typically around 30 degrees.
- File Each Tooth Evenly: File each tooth with the same number of strokes, ensuring that they are all the same length and angle.
- Lower the Depth Gauges: After filing the teeth, use the depth gauge tool to lower the depth gauges (rakers). The depth gauges should be slightly lower than the cutting edge of the teeth. Consult your chainsaw’s manual for the correct depth gauge setting.
Common Mistakes and How to Avoid Them
- Filing at the Wrong Angle: Filing at the wrong angle can damage the teeth and reduce their cutting efficiency.
- Filing Unevenly: Filing unevenly can cause the chain to cut crookedly.
- Ignoring the Depth Gauges: Ignoring the depth gauges can cause the chain to grab and kick back.

4. Fuel and Lubrication: The Lifeline of Your CS4400
Proper fuel and lubrication are the lifeblood of your Echo CS4400. Using the correct fuel mixture and keeping the chain properly lubricated will significantly extend the life of your chainsaw and ensure optimal performance.
Fuel Mixture: Getting It Right
The Echo CS4400 requires a specific fuel mixture of gasoline and two-stroke oil. Using the wrong mixture can lead to engine damage.
- Recommended Mixture: The recommended fuel mixture for the CS4400 is typically 50:1 (50 parts gasoline to 1 part two-stroke oil). Always refer to your owner’s manual for the exact ratio.
- Use High-Quality Gasoline: Use high-quality gasoline with an octane rating of 89 or higher. Avoid using gasoline that contains ethanol, as it can damage the engine.
- Use High-Quality Two-Stroke Oil: Use a high-quality two-stroke oil specifically designed for air-cooled engines.
- Mix Fuel Fresh: Mix fuel fresh each time you need it. Gasoline can degrade over time, especially when mixed with oil.
Chain Lubrication: Keeping Things Smooth
Proper chain lubrication is essential for preventing wear and tear on the chain, bar, and sprocket.
- Use Chainsaw Bar and Chain Oil: Use a chainsaw bar and chain oil specifically designed for this purpose. Avoid using other types of oil, as they may not provide adequate lubrication.
- Check Oil Level Regularly: Check the oil level in the oil reservoir regularly and refill as needed.
- Adjust Oil Flow: Adjust the oil flow to match the cutting conditions. When cutting hardwoods or in hot weather, you may need to increase the oil flow.
- Clean the Oiler: Periodically clean the oiler to ensure that it is functioning properly.
Common Mistakes and How to Avoid Them
- Using the Wrong Fuel Mixture: Using the wrong fuel mixture can lead to engine damage. Always use the recommended mixture.
- Using Old Fuel: Using old fuel can cause the engine to run poorly or not at all. Mix fuel fresh each time you need it.
- Using the Wrong Oil: Using the wrong oil can damage the chain, bar, and sprocket. Always use chainsaw bar and chain oil.
- Ignoring Oil Level: Ignoring the oil level can lead to premature wear and damage. Check the oil level regularly and refill as needed.

5. Maintaining Your CS4400: A Proactive Approach
Regular maintenance is crucial for keeping your Echo CS4400 in top condition and preventing costly repairs. A proactive approach to maintenance will extend the life of your chainsaw and ensure that it is always ready to perform.
Essential Maintenance Tasks
- Air Filter Cleaning: Clean the air filter regularly to ensure that the engine is getting enough air. A dirty air filter can reduce engine power and increase fuel consumption.
- Spark Plug Inspection: Inspect the spark plug regularly and replace it if necessary. A faulty spark plug can cause the engine to run poorly or not at all.
- Fuel Filter Replacement: Replace the fuel filter periodically to prevent dirt and debris from entering the engine.
- Bar and Chain Inspection: Inspect the bar and chain regularly for signs of wear and damage. Replace the bar and chain as needed.
- Sprocket Inspection: Inspect the sprocket regularly for signs of wear and damage. Replace the sprocket as needed.
- Chain Brake Inspection: Inspect the chain brake regularly to ensure that it is functioning properly.
- Sharpening: Keep the chain sharp by filing it regularly.
- Cleaning: Clean the chainsaw after each use to remove sawdust and debris.
- Storage: Store the chainsaw in a dry place when not in use.
Creating a Maintenance Schedule
- Daily: Check the chain tension, oil level, and fuel level. Clean the chainsaw after each use.
- Weekly: Clean the air filter, inspect the spark plug, and sharpen the chain.
- Monthly: Replace the fuel filter, inspect the bar and chain, and inspect the sprocket.
- Annually: Have the chainsaw serviced by a qualified technician.
